Dontrell Hilliard impressing at Titans minicamp

Jim Wyatt of the Tennessee Titans’ official website reports that RB Dontrell Hilliard has impressed while carrying a heavy workload in minicamp as he competes with rookie RB Hassan Haskins for the primary backup role behind Derrick Henry. (Jim Wyatt, Tennessee Titans Official Website)

Fantasy Impact:

According to Wyatt, Hilliard was on the receiving end of two Ryan Tannehill touchdown passes during a minicamp practice earlier this week and has been heavily involved in the offense in practice. Superstar RB Derrick Henry will be the unquestioned workhorse RB for the Titans in 2022, but the primary backup RB role for the team could ultimately be a valuable one for fantasy managers as Henry enters his age 28 season and is coming off of the first major injury of his career. The Titans have been a run-first offense during Mike Vrabel’s tenure as the team's head coach, and the team stayed true to their ground and pound identity even after losing Henry for the final nine games of 2021. Hilliard impressed in limited opportunity last season, having averaged an outstanding 6.3 yards per attempt and he rushed for 131 yards in the only game he was given over ten carries. If Hilliard can beat out Haskins, he may be a wise late-round dart throw in best ball formats in the event that Henry was to miss time again in 2022.
